Electronic Concepts An Introduction Pdf Rectifier Electronic Circuits The field of organic electronics continues to move forward at a swift pace for future, next generation electronics. in this regard, this chapter explores the key organic materials and devices in the development of electronic devices. Organic electronics is an emerging and interdisciplinary field that combines principles of organic chemistry, materials science, solid state physics, and electrical engineering to develop electronic devices using carbon based (organic) materials.
